In that case it’s really one cluster. Make sure to set different rack ids for 
each server room so kafka will ensure that the replicas always span both floors 
and you don’t loose availability of data if a server room goes down.
You will have to configure one addition zookeeper node in each site which you 
will only ever startup if a site goes down because otherwise 2 of 4 zookeeper 
nodes is not a quorum.Again you would be better with 3 nodes because then you 
would only have to do this in the site that has the single active node.

>>>> Jens,
>>>> 
>>>> I think you are correct that a 4 node zookeeper ensemble can be made to
>>>> work but it will be slightly less resilient than a 3 node ensemble
>>> because
>>>> it can only tolerate 1 failure (same as a 3 node ensemble) and the
>>>> likelihood of node failures is higher because there is 1 more node that
>>>> could fail.
>>>> So it SHOULD be an odd number of zookeeper nodes (not MUST).
